您现在的位置是:首页 > 技术博客 > linux下安装PHP扩展安装Redis扩展

linux下安装PHP扩展安装Redis扩展

2021-07-13文远技术博客810275

下面介绍的是在linux下如何安装PHP的扩展,我用的的扩展是redis的扩展

1、下载redis扩展(linux版本)

[root@bogon ~]# wget http://pecl.php.net/get/redis-5.3.4.tgz

注意:如果提示wget命令未定义的话使用 yum  wget 进行安装

2、解压进行安装扩展

[root@bogon ~]# tar zxfv redis-5.3.4.tgz
[root@bogon ~]# cd redis-5.3.4
#进入redis扩展目录后运行phpize命令
[root@bogon redis-5.3.4]# phpize

注意:我的phpize命令添加到了全局命令里面,所以可以直接使用,如果你的报错未定义phpsiz则要使用 php安装目录/bin/phpize

出现类似于下面的提示则说明执行成功

linux下安装PHP扩展安装Redis扩展
查看当前目录,多了一个可执行的文件名字是:configure

运行以下命令进行编译和安装

[root@bogon redis-5.3.4]# ./configure --with-php-config=/usr/local/php/bin/php-config

注意:--with-php-config=后面跟的是:你的PHP安装路径/bin/php-config

编译完成后执行安装

[root@bogon redis-5.3.4]# make && make install

安装完成后出现安装目录的提示信息,则说明安装成功

Installing shared extensions: /usr/local/php/lib/php/extensions/no-debug-non-zts-20190902/


3、修改php.ini文件

打开php.ini文件,一般在PHP安装目录下的etc下

[root@bogon redis-5.3.4]# vim /usr/local/php/etc/php.ini

找到扩展的位置添加如下代码

extension=redis

保存退出重启php-fpm

自己查看自己重启php-fpm的方式

重启完成后查看是否安装成功

[root@bogon redis-5.3.4]# php -m

这个命令会吧所有PHP执行的扩展列出来,看能否找到redis扩展,找的到说明成功

完成!

文章评论

看完文章了吗?谁便说点吧

发表 captcha

暂无评论